Address

MC3zbDNDfmus1LHfy2vxim9QWK4XagqkCyCopy

Total Received

88.88761517 LTC

Total Sent

85.05680464 LTC

№ Transactions

1080

Final Balance

3.83081053 LTC

Transactions
Filter